You can add your own plugins and use them just like any other.<br>
You just need to place them under <code>components/plugins/</code> and they'll become available.</p></div>Tasos Laskostag:support.arachni-scanner.com,2012-07-01:Comment/433818802017-09-13T06:27:09Z2017-09-13T06:27:12ZCould arachni Support Custom Scan Plugins?<div><p>is there some guide for checks or plugins development?<br>
